Arriving in Arequipa I felt everything was white, from the buildings with a Spanish ring to them, to the snowcapped, dormant volcano Misti towering “behind”. All bathing in the sunshine. The city’s focal point is the beautiful Plaza de Armas. Even though it is worth a visit, there are few things which warrant spending a longer time here. Nevertheless, I got what I came for, a jump-off point for visiting Colca Canyon.
